LIST OF ACTIVE PORT MARINE CIRCULARS

This circular supersedes Port Marine Circular No. 1 of 2021.

2 The list of active Port Marine Circulars is in the ANNEX.

3 The contents of the circulars can be found on MPA's website


(http://www.mpa.gov.sg) under the heading "Circulars and Notices".

4 The contents of circulars that are not included in the active list are deemed
to have been sufficiently promulgated and can be found either in the MPA
Regulations or on MPA’s website.
